First, the house-- The first floor is very open, with a big living area (and sectional sofa) opening to a large dining room that comfortably seated all of us. The kitchen is spacious, and easy for one or two people to cook in. The knives are even sharp! There's a small bedroom on the first floor with a day bed. For some reason, it was the coolest room in the house. Upstairs are three more bedrooms (one with bunk beds!), the master suite, and another full bath. The beds were comfortable, everyone slept like babies, and the master suite has a kickass deck. There'a big back deck nestled in the redwoods with views of the river. Going towards the back yard, there's a nice hottub that we barely used because it was super hot outside. The yard is totally fenced (great for the dogs), and the back yard had fruit trees that will be great for a later guest once the fruit is ripe. The houses's location beside the beach path means you can go from front door to water in under two minutes. We spent a lot of time at the beach, and got to know some of the very nice neighbors. All in all, the best vacation house we've rented yet. Rob was super easy to work with, and I highly recommend.

This place is a fabulous hidden gem about ten minutes from downtown Healdsburg and only a few minutes from nearby wineries. The cottage is situated at the end of a long driveway, overlooking rolling hills that you'll find in this part of Sonoma. It's a clean and comfortable home converted from an old barn, where the owners now live. And they've done an amazing job updating the one-bedroom with a new bath, modern appliances, a large flat screen tv, and even a mini-kitchen stocked with local croissants, jams, and organic teas... But what got me is that unlike so many wine country B&Bs that look cute online and end up feeling corporate in person, the place doesn't feel contrived or pretentious at all -- it's relaxing, romantic, and rustic (how's that for alliteration) in a very real way, which is exactly how a weekend in wine country should be done. Also, gotta love how spacious and warm the place is, even in November (our favorite time to do wine country...). It was just two of us this weekend, but the place could easily host up to 6 with the two queen-sized futons in the living room mean. If you're able to, check out the cute gardens full of local produce all around the home and if you're lucky, you may meet the most awesome Yellow Lab ever. Did I mention the owners even make their own organic honey -- how sweet is that?
